GOVERNOR LEADS MARCH OF DIMES 37TH ANNUAL WALKAMERICA

April 14 - "This is about our keiki, their families and giving them a good life," Governor Lingle said at the 37th March of Dimes WalkAmerica.  "We want them to get through the first weeks of their lives so they have the opportunity to experience the joy and challenges of life," she added. 

The Governor and community leaders led a file-mile walk, one of five being held around the state in March and April, in support of the March of Dimes' mission to prevent birth defects and infant mortality.
